How they compare
Poland currently reports 486,900 against 461,375 in Cote d'Ivoire, a difference of 25,525.
That makes Poland's figure about 1.1 times Cote d'Ivoire's.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Poland has been ahead every year.
Cote d'Ivoire ranks 49th and Poland ranks 46th of 191 countries.
Poland has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cote d'Ivoire | Poland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 246,222 | 553,344 | 307,122 | Poland |
| 2000s | 365,544 | 646,936 | 281,392 | Poland |
| 2010s | 439,033 | 532,969 | 93,936 | Poland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
